One of the primary problems commercial tree services help solve is the risk posed by hazardous trees. Overgrown or diseased trees can threaten buildings, power lines, and pedestrians, especially during storms or high winds. Tree removal and pruning services are often necessary to eliminate dead or unstable branches that could fall and cause damage or injury. Additionally, these services can prevent the spread of tree diseases and pests, which might otherwise compromise the health of multiple trees across a property. Regular assessments and maintenance can mitigate the need for emergency interventions by proactively managing tree health and stability.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Tree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Coweta County,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Tree Removal Costs - The cost for removing a single tree typically ranges from $200 to $2,000, depending on size and complexity. Smaller trees may cost around $200 to $500, while larger or hazardous trees can exceed $1,500. Local pros can provide estimates based on tree height and location.
Pruning and Trimming Expenses - Basic pruning services generally cost between $75 and $450 per tree. More extensive trimming or shaping can increase costs, especially for mature trees or hard-to-reach branches. Costs vary based on tree size and the extent of work needed.
Stump Grinding Prices - Stump removal using grinding services typically ranges from $75 to $300 per stump. Larger stumps or those in hard-to-access areas may cost more. Service providers can assess stump size to determine precise pricing.
Emergency Tree Service Rates - Emergency or storm-related tree services often cost between $150 and $1,200, depending on the urgency and scope of work. These services may include hazard removal or securing fallen branches, with costs varying by situation compl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
